The Supreme Court Allows Idaho to Block Emergency Abortions
Late on Friday, the Supreme Court ruled that Idaho can enforce its total abortion ban even when it’s necessary to save a pregnant person’s life, lifting a lower court’s injunction from 2022 that blocked this part of the law. It’s Now Even More Dangerous to Be a Pregnant Person in Texas
On Tuesday evening, the famously conservative Fifth Circuit Court of Appeals in Texas ruled that emergency rooms aren’t required to perform life-saving abortions under the Emergency Medical Treatment and Labor Act (EMTALA), regardless of federal guidance. Read more...
